Elvis Costello pumps up Hillary Clinton's presidential campaign

The veteran will wish the presidential candidate a happy birthday

Elvis Costello is set to perform at Hillary Clinton’s birthday party, to be held at New York’s Beacon Theatre on October 25.

The party is organised by former President Bill Clinton to celebrate presidential hopeful and New York Senator Hillary’s 60th birthday.

Other acts are likely to be announced, seeing as Bill ’s own birthday party last year included performances from The Rolling Stones, Jack White and Christina Aguilera, and was filmed by none other than Martin Scorsese.

The shindig is also a fundraiser for Hillary’s Presidential campaign, and is open to the public with tickets ranging in price from $250 – $2,300.
